The Love of the Brothers Rott (German: Die Liebe der BrĂ¼der Rott) is a 1929 German silent film directed by Erich Waschneck and starring Olga Chekhova, Jean Dax and Paul Henckels.[1] It was shot at the Staaken Studios in Berlin. The film's sets were designed by the art director Andrej Andrejew.
